Released together with FOREVER in EP, NEEDING YOU is available on all major online music channels (Spotify, Deezer, iTunes, Google Play Music etc ..). The song is accompanied by a video shot in the studios of the Carrara sculptor cooperative and the bridges of Vara at the Carrara marble quarries.
With the participation of professional dancers from the New Arcobaleno Dance, Maurizio Pasqualetti, Francesca Donati and Michela Passani, already actors in the previous video of Denora of the piece FOREVER.
This piece promises to be a new success for the singer-saxophonist thanks to the collaboration of a team of motivated professionals. The videoclip is directed by Davide Barducci, professional of SBM STUDIO, Massa Carrara and Denora together with his manager took part directly in the final assembly.
The single follows FOREVER, released in October and the protagonist of over 650,000 visits on YouTube, on the front page of the recommended and trending videos in various countries around the world, broadcast in various radio and international discos, finished in the top 10 in the Euro Indie Chart by 5 weeks even with a 2nd position.
The successor piece of eight other songs produced by Denora, will be an integral part of an album in progress, all made of Pop Dance pieces, with some Lounge notes and has all the features to repeat the success of FOREVER.
NEEDING YOU is a piece with pop and dance sounds with a strong influence of Italian indies, it presents a text created totally by the artist Denora who talks about a couple who has reached the end of the love affair, but still bound by lack and the need to meet again. However, it happens that they will never meet again, as often happens.
Biography
DENORA, gifted singer and saxophonist, bases her roots in the culture of pop dance music sought with attention to the lyrics and contents of her own pieces that are an expression of the artist's soul, usually positive and cheerful, sometimes sad and melancholy. The artist has often lent himself to live performances for private events as well as for public events both in France, Italy, Russia, Poland, Switzerland ...
